direction

[ Funktion ]

public direction(valueNew: 'normal' | 'reverse' | 'alternate' | 'alternate-reverse' | null): this;

Stellt die Ablaufrichtung der Animation ein. Die Ablaufrichtung betrifft nicht nur die Reihenfolge der Keyframes sondern auch die Timing-Funktion.

Parameter

Name

Typ

Beschreibung

valueNew

string, null

Die Ablaufrichtung der Animation. Wenn null übergeben wird, wird der Standardwert 'normal' verwendet.

'reverse' lässt die Animation rückwärts laufen, 'alternate' kehrt bei Animationen mit mehr als einer Wiederholung die Richtung bei jeder Wiederholung um und 'alternate-reverse' funktioniert wie 'alternate', nur das mit der umgekehrten Richtung angefangen wird.

Rückgabewert

Typ

Beschreibung

TcHmi.Animation

Diese Methode gibt ihr Elternobjekt zurück, um eine Aneinanderkettung von Methodenaufrufen zu ermöglichen.

Beispiel – JavaScript

var animation = new TcHmi.Animation('ViewDesktopBeckhoffLogo', '');
var directionDefault = animation.direction(); // 'normal'
animation.direction('alternate');
var direction = animation.direction(); // 'alternate'
direction 1:

Verfügbar ab Version 1.8